I found myself childless on the weekend of a quilt show - two words - ROAD TRIP!!!
I headed off to Hershey, Pa. to Quilt Odyssey 2014. Never been to Hershey ever, not even as a child on a field trip with school. (I grew up outside of Philadelphia).
Off I went - nothing better than a quilty road trip! I enjoyed the show - lots of great older Americana quilts from the region. Gorgeous award winners - far too many photos to share I am afraid. Loved every inspiring minute. It was a bit crowded but then again it was Saturday and it was to be expected. No issues - I can wait my turn to see and photo a quilt.
Fantastic merchants mall too - loads of familiar shops and many new ones too. And yes a few new treasures and threads jumped in my bag!
Once numb and overwhelmed with ideas swirling, I headed back east on the slow road stopping at Bird-in-Hand and Intercourse. I have always wanted to stop here since I started quilting but it was either a husband thing or 2 small boy things. Either way - nope. That day - just me and I stopped at each and every shop I could find! And I certainly never get tired if having to slow down for the Amish horse and buggies! They just make my heart sing!
Side note here - having grown up relatively nearby and spending a few days a year with elder aunties driving through the Amish Country the one thing I noticed was color. When I was little the ladies were in dark colors always - even summer. Not this time - bright solids were everywhere on the ladies and the young boys. And the clothes lines - love!
